Egress window installation services involve creating an accessible exit point from a basement or lower-level living space by installing specialized windows that meet safety and building code requirements. The process typically includes cutting into existing foundation walls, installing a window well, and ensuring proper drainage and structural integrity. These windows are designed to provide a large enough opening to allow for emergency escape and rescue, as well as to bring in natural light and fresh air into subterranean areas. Professional installers focus on integrating the window seamlessly with the existing structure while maintaining safety standards and ensuring durability over time.
This service addresses several common issues faced by property owners with below-ground living spaces. One primary concern is the safety hazard posed by insufficient egress options, which can be problematic during emergencies such as fires or other evacuations. Additionally, inadequate natural light and ventilation can make basements less habitable and more prone to moisture problems. Installing an egress window helps resolve these issues by providing a safe exit route, increasing natural illumination, and improving airflow. Proper installation also reduces the risk of water infiltration and structural damage, contributing to the long-term integrity of the property.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for egress window installation typically ranges from $300 to $800 per window, depending on the type of window chosen and the size. Higher-end options or custom designs may increase expenses.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project requirements.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ing an egress window usually fall between $1,000 and $3,000 per window. Factors influencing the price include the complexity of the excavation and finishing work needed.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es.
Permitting and Inspection - Permitting fees and inspection costs generally range from $100 to $500, varying by location and project scope. Some areas require specific permits for egress window installation, which can impact overall costs. Local contractors can assist with permit acquisition and compliance.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include structural modifications or waterproofing, typically adding $200 to $1,000 to the project. These expenses depend on the existing foundation and basement conditions. Local professionals can evaluate site-specific needs for accurate pricing.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
